Skills Gained from AI Short Courses
The actual value of AI short courses lies in the skills learners acquire. These courses are carefully designed to focus on the most in-demand technical and analytical competencies. Participants not only learn how to code but also understand how to apply AI to real-world business problems.
Beyond technical training, short courses often emphasise problem-solving, adaptability, and critical thinking. This combination of technical and soft skills makes graduates versatile and job-ready.
Core skills taught include:
- Python programming – mastering libraries such as NumPy, Pandas, and TensorFlow
- Machine learning algorithms – building regression, classification, and clustering models
- Data handling and visualisation – turning raw data into actionable insights
- Natural language processing (NLP) – creating chatbots, sentiment analysis, and language models
- AI project deployment – integrating solutions into real-world environments

Real-World Applications of AI Skills
One of the most powerful aspects of AI short courses is their focus on real-world applications. Learners don’t just acquire theoretical knowledge; they apply skills through projects, simulations, and case studies. These practical experiences allow them to demonstrate their ability to solve industry challenges.
From automating customer service through chatbots to building predictive healthcare models, the applications of AI are vast. By working on such projects during short courses, learners gain confidence and the ability to showcase their skills to potential employers.
Real-world applications can be seen in:
- Fraud detection in banking
- Predictive healthcare diagnostics
- Customer personalisation in retail
- Process automation in manufacturing
- Conversational AI tools such as chatbots
